iODBC

iODBC
Разработчик(и)OpenLink Software, Ке Джин
Стабильный релиз
3.52.14 [1] / 2021-02-21 [2]
Репозиторий
  • github.com/openlink/iODBC
Операционная системаКроссплатформенный
ТипAPI доступа к данным
ЛицензияBSD , LGPL
Веб-сайтwww.iodbc.org

iODBC — это инициатива с открытым исходным кодом , управляемая OpenLink Software. Это платформенно-независимый ODBC SDK и предложение среды выполнения, которое позволяет разрабатывать ODBC-совместимые приложения и драйверы вне платформы Windows . Главные цели этого проекта следующие:

  • Упростите процесс переноса приложений ODBC с Windows на другие платформы.
  • Упростите процесс переноса драйверов ODBC с Windows на другие платформы.
  • Создайте единообразный опыт использования ODBC на всех платформах

История

iODBC появился в результате совместных усилий OpenLink Software и Ke Jin. OpenLink Software выпустила Driver Manager-less ODBC SDK, который она назвала Universal DataBase Connectivity ( UDBC ) в 1993 году из-за спорадического характера реализаций общих библиотек на платформах Unix . Ke Jin использовал UDBC в качестве вдохновения для создания Driver Manager для ODBC за пределами платформы Windows.

Со временем Ке Джин и OpenLink Software решили объединить эти усилия в единое предложение с открытым исходным кодом под лицензией LGPL .

Этот процесс происходил в то время, когда Free Software Foundation стремился сделать iODBC предложением GPL . Задержка в определении окончательного статуса лицензирования для iODBC привела к появлению UnixODBC и привела к ответвлению платформенно -независимого ODBC SDK и среды выполнения, которые существуют сегодня. Драйверы и приложения, написанные с использованием любого SDK, остались совместимыми (дань уважения обоим проектам).

  • домашняя страница iODBC

Ссылки

  1. ^ "Stable (v3.52.14)". iODBC.org . Получено 18 апреля 2021 г. .
  2. ^ "Выпущена стабильная версия iODBC 3.52.14". iODBC.org . Получено 18 апреля 2021 г. .
Взято с "https://en.wikipedia.org/w/index.php?title=IODBC&oldid=1069729664"